Let Nature Speak For Itself
Houston is home to stunning venues where nature creates the perfect backdrop. From oak-lined estates on the city’s outskirts to waterfront settings and nearby Hill Country escapes, couples can let the season’s scenery set the tone. An outdoor ceremony framed by towering trees or overlooking serene water views captures fall’s romantic essence without needing heavy embellishment.
Rustic Venues
Rustic Houston venues shine in autumn. Barns and ranch-inspired spaces feel especially welcoming in cooler weather, offering couples the perfect mix of Southern charm and seasonal warmth. Pair these spaces with glowing candlelight and fall-toned florals for a look that feels cozy yet elevated.
Fall Foliage-Inspired Décor
While Houston doesn’t boast Northeast-style fall color, seasonal branches, leaves and natural textures can be woven into your wedding décor. Think foliage garlands draped across tables, leaf-accented place settings or backdrops of golden leaves for your ceremony. These organic details bring autumn’s beauty indoors and tie your celebration seamlessly to the season.
Wooden Tables & Autumn-Hued Accents
For a grounded yet refined tablescape, exposed wooden farm tables are a perfect seasonal choice. Style them with fall-colored linens, amber-toned glassware, and gold flatware, then layer in rich-hued florals and textured runners in velvet or linen. The combination of warm wood and seasonal accents creates an inviting setting that feels timeless for fall.
Rich Hues For Bridesmaids
Fall is the season for drama and depth, and bridesmaid fashion embraces that beautifully. Dresses in jewel tones—think emerald, plum, sapphire, and ruby—bring richness to any bridal party. Whether you choose matching gowns for a strikingly cohesive look or mix and match within the same palette, these deep hues photograph stunningly against Houston’s ballrooms and outdoor backdrops.
Alfresco Celebrations
Houston’s mild fall weather makes open-air weddings a dream. Host your reception under the stars with glowing string lights, candlelit centerpieces and the crisp evening air, setting the mood for a night of celebration.
Sunset-Inspired Florals
Capture the beauty of a Texas sunset with blooms in burnt orange, rust, blush, and deep red. Seasonal favorites like dahlias, ranunculus, and roses add richness, while textured accents like dried grasses or berries make each bouquet feel perfectly autumnal.
Chic Bridal Accessories
Fall is the perfect time to play with stylish details. Opera-length satin gloves or sheer embroidered options add a vintage-inspired layer to bridal style, ideal for cooler evenings or black-tie celebrations in Houston ballrooms.
Fall-Inspired Foods
Elevate your menu with cozy yet refined bites. Guests will love light bites like mini grilled cheese sandwiches paired with creamy tomato bisque for a warm, playful nod to fall comfort food that feels just right for a Houston wedding.
Fall-Inspired Cakes
Your wedding cake is another place to infuse autumn’s charm. A classic naked cake with minimal frosting feels rustic yet elegant, especially when adorned with seasonal blooms, berries, or textured greenery. For an even stronger seasonal nod, consider decorating with fall foliage accents. Think golden leaves, sprigs of eucalyptus, or clusters of figs. These simple details transform your cake into a centerpiece that ties beautifully into your autumn celebration.
